Bad Bunny took on hosting duties for SNL’s season 51 premiere – and the rapper’s opening monologue was humorously crashed by Jon Hamm.

The 31-year-old musician, who is slated to perform at the Super Bowl LX Halftime Show next year, shared his thoughts on his recent residency in Puerto Rico and mentioned some famous faces that attended the events.

A few months earlier in August, Hamm went viral after footage showed him grooving at Bad Bunny’s concert. 

At the time, the Mad Men alum donned a bucket hat and patterned shirt while also holding a drink in his hand as he showcased his dance moves. 

“Some celebrities came to my show. A few of them were on drugs,” Bad Bunny informed the audience. “And I won’t name names, but one of them was Jon Hamm.”

The reel was then played, causing the crowd to erupt into laughter. ‘Actually, that wasn’t Jon Hamm, that was Juan Jamon,’ the star joked.

The camera then cut to Hamm in the live audience as he flashed a big smile while mimicking the dance moves. 

The actor also sported the same outfit he had worn to the concert as the audience broke out into applause over the surprise cameo. 

‘I think he’s obsessed with me,’ Bad Bunny added.

The music artist also poked fun at his own choreography during his performances on stage. 

He continued, “I just wrapped up a 31-show stint in Puerto Rico and I’m still a bit exhausted because each show lasts three hours and involves a lot of complex choreography.”

A short video then showed the rapper slowly jumping from left to right rather than doing complicated dance moves. 

‘That looked simple, but that took me a long time to learn,’ Bad Bunny told the crowd. ‘Trust me.’  

The rapper also referenced to his upcoming headlining gig at the Super Bowl Halftime Show next year in February.

‘Anyway, you might not know this, but I’m doing the Super Bowl Halftime Show. And I’m very happy, and I think everyone is happy about it.’ 

The star also shared, ‘And I know that people all around the world who love my music are also happy.’

Bad Bunny then began to speak in Spanish, with people from the live audience continuing to cheer in response. 

He briefly paused and instead of translating, he jokingly added, ‘And if you didn’t understand what I just said, you have four months to learn.’ 

The performer had the chance to show off his comedic skills while appearing a number of skits throughout the night. 

In one, Bad Bunny played a character named Thomas who was joining his pals for brunch to catch up. 

The group talked about films that they want to see, such as Leonardo DiCaprio’s latest movie One Battle After Another as well as Netflix’s Frankenstein. 

The rapper then said he enjoyed the animated movie KPop Demon Hunters – which dropped on Netflix in August.
